Tax bill anatomy
What can change your actual bill in ZIP 43605
Use the ZIP estimate to compare neighborhoods, then verify these parcel-level inputs before relying on a payment estimate.
Assessed value
The ZCTA median home value is $46,000, but your bill starts with the local assessed value for a specific parcel.
Effective rate
The displayed rate is 2.28%, derived from median tax paid divided by median home value.
Exemptions
Homestead, senior, veteran, disability, and local exemptions can reduce taxable value. Confirm eligibility before estimating escrow.
Reassessment
A purchase can change assessed value depending on Ohio and county rules. Ask how sale price affects the next assessment cycle.
Escrow impact
The median tax paid in this ZCTA equals about $87 per month before insurance, HOA dues, or special assessments.
Assessor verification
Lucas County assessor or tax collector records are the source of truth for parcel taxes, appeal windows, and exemptions.

Property Tax Analysis
Property Tax Insights for ZIP 43605
Property owners in ZIP code 43605 (Toledo, Ohio) pay a median of $1,047/year in property taxes on homes valued at $46,000. This translates to an effective tax rate of 2.28%, which is 84% above the Ohio state average of 1.24%.
The monthly property tax burden for a median-valued home in 43605 is approximately $87, which factors into escrow payments on mortgages. This ZIP code is located within Lucas County. This is $1,257 less than the Ohio average of $2,304/year.
Compared to similar ZIP codes in Ohio, 43605 has higher property taxes. ZIP codes with similar effective rates include 45405 (2.27%) and 44126 (2.26%).
In Toledo, property taxes represent approximately 2.9% of the median household income of $36,389, providing context for the relative tax burden on homeowners in this area.
Lucas County follows Ohio's triennial reassessment cycle, with revaluations conducted by the county auditor on a three-year rotation that affects your assessed value through 2024 and beyond. Primary residence owners automatically receive a 2.5% Owner-Occupancy Credit, and seniors 65+ and disabled homeowners qualify for the Homestead Exemption — apply with the Lucas County Auditor's office before your first tax bill arrives. The Lucas County Auditor (419-213-4800) can provide your property's next reassessment year and help you file for senior/disabled exemptions that may save hundreds annually.
